The Science Behind Red Light Therapy

Red Light Therapy, or low-level light therapy, uses specific wavelengths of light to penetrate deep into the skin and tissues, initiating a cascade of cellular activities. It’s not just about lighting up your skin; it’s about igniting the regenerative processes within. This therapy operates on a cellular level, targeting fibroblasts, keratinocytes, and immune cells to boost collagen and elastin production—key players in maintaining the skin’s structural integrity and elasticity. Additionally, RLT enhances ATP (adenosine triphosphate) production, ramping up cellular energy and improving blood circulation for healthier, more vibrant skin.

Unveiling the Benefits of Red Light Therapy

  1. Wrinkle Reduction: The natural aging process, compounded by external factors like sun damage and pollution, leads to decreased collagen production over time. RLT steps in as a powerful ally, stimulating collagen synthesis to combat fine lines and sagging skin, offering a non-invasive solution to age gracefully.
  2. Scar Diminishing: Initially explored for its wound-healing capabilities, RLT has shown promising results in reducing the appearance of acne scars, burn scars, and other forms of scarring by enhancing the skin’s healing process and cellular regeneration.
  3. Acne Treatment: Unlike traditional sunlight, which can harm the skin, RLT offers a safe alternative to combat acne. It works by reducing oil production and altering cellular behavior that contributes to acne without the harmful effects of UV exposure.
  4. Inflammation and Redness Reduction: RLT uniquely alleviates inflammation and redness in the skin, making it a potent treatment for conditions like rosacea and acne. It helps in minimizing oxidative stress and soothe inflamed skin areas.
  5. Muscle Recovery: Beyond skincare, RLT provides benefits for muscle recovery by penetrating deeper tissues with longer wavelengths. It accelerates recovery post-exercise and reduces muscle soreness, making it a valuable tool for athletes and those with active lifestyles.
